๐ŸŽฌ Lights. Camera. Action.

Turn your passion for storytelling into a career with the new Film & TV Production course at Sligo College of FET.

This exciting programme is designed to equip learners with the knowledge, practical skills, and industry experience needed to work in television studio production, film crew roles, and single-camera production environments.

Students will gain hands-on experience in: ๐Ÿ“น Single-camera production
๐ŸŽž๏ธ Non-linear film and video editing
๐ŸŽฅ Television and film production techniques
๐Ÿ“ฐ Media analysis and audience engagement

Explore how producers, advertisers, and audiences shape modern media while building the creative and technical skills needed for the screen industries.

Whether you want to step directly into the world of Film & TV production or progress to further and higher education, this course is your opportunity to get started.

Congratulations to the three winners of the Erasmus+ Content Creation Competition ๐ŸŽ‰๐ŸŒ

1st Place โ€“ Kaylin Monds, Food Science ๐Ÿ‡ฎ๐Ÿ‡น worked in Bologna, Italy in a food processing company, gaining hands-on industry skills and international insight ๐Ÿโœจ

2nd Place โ€“ Hazel Parkes, Early Learning & Care ๐Ÿ‡ช๐Ÿ‡ธ spent time in Mรกlaga working in a childcare centre, building practical childcare experience while embracing a new culture โ˜€๏ธ๐Ÿ‘ถ

3rd Place โ€“ Sophie Burke, Occupational Therapy Assistant ๐Ÿง  During three weeks in a brain injury clinic in Malaga, Sophie developed valuable clinical skills and gained meaningful experience supporting patients ๐Ÿค

Each of them shared powerful stories from their time abroad, showcasing not just their placements but the true impact of Erasmus+ โœจ

From Italy to Spain, their journeys highlight how learning outside the classroom can shape your future in the most inspiring ways ๐Ÿ™Œ

We are so proud to see our students represent Sligo College of FET with such creativity and passion ๐Ÿ’™

Best of luck to our four Level 6 Animal Care students who have arrived in Finland today to begin their week-long group mobility at POKE College in Northern Central Finland ๐Ÿ‡ซ๐Ÿ‡ฎ๐Ÿพ

Over the next week, they will take part in both practical and classroom-based learning. Activities will include assisting with the daily care of animals in animal houses, supporting husbandry and welfare practices, and collaborating on a group project with Finnish Animal Care students.

Our Tourism and Art students from Sligo College of FET had an incredible learning experience this week with a visit to the Titanic Quarter and Art Galleries in Belfast ๐Ÿšข

Exploring this iconic destination, students gained valuable insights into the story of the RMS Titanic โ€” from its design and construction to its historic voyage and legacy. They also deepened their understanding of heritage tourism, visitor experience design, and how world-class attractions engage audiences through storytelling and immersive exhibits.

The trip offered a fantastic opportunity to connect classroom learning with real-world tourism practices, while also experiencing one of Irelandโ€™s most significant cultural and historical sites.
